Reactions of 1-nitrocyclohexene with N,N-binucleophiles
Efremova,Vakulenko,Lysenko,Bushmarinov,Lapshina,Berkova,Berestovitskaya
, p. 2298 - 2305 (2011/04/14)
A modification of 1-nitrocyclohexene synthesis is proposed; its reaction with phenylhydrazine and benzoic acid hydrazide is shown to afford monoadducts, and with hydrazine hydrate, bisaduct. With diphenylguanidine occurs heterocyclization to 1-phenyl-2-N-phenylamino-4,5,6,7-tetrahydrobenzimidazole, whose structure is confirmed by the X-ray diffraction data. The analysis performed for this compound of the electron density distribution function in the crystal made it possible to estimate the charge distribution, π-electrons delocalization nature, and the role of N-H···N, C-H···H-C and C-H···C interactions in the formation of the crystal packing.
